SAINT JOHN – After 17 years in the real estate industry, Jason Stephen is now Vice-President of the Canada Real Estate Association.
He was elected on Monday and tells us they work with the Federal government hosting hosting political action days every year.
Stephen says one ask they bring to government is too increase the limits for the homebuyer’s program which has only changed once since the early 90’s.
He says we all know the price of real estate is not the same now as it was in the 90’s so they are always asking the Feds to index it to some sort of inflation.
He says there is some travel involved but a lot of the work he can do from home thanks to technology.
We asked Jason Stephen if working in provincial politics helps him in his career and he says dealing with people is dealng with people.
When he got started in real estate he treated it as launching a campaign because that is his background.
